pertama login dengan root lalu, Ketik perintah di bawah ini:
nano /etc/network/interfeces
lalu hapus semua peintah-perintah yang ada di dalam, ketik masuk ip dibawah ini sesuai dengan gambar.
Setelah anda mengisi ip di atas , untuk menyimpannya tekan ctrl+x lalu tekan y, dan tekan enter
Restart networknya dengan mengetik perintah dibawah ini:
/etc/init.d/networking restart
Setelah itu coba ping apaka sudah connect atau belum.
Selajutnya kita akan menginstal DNS server, dengan mengetik perintah dibawah ini; jangan lupa memasukan cd debiannya.
apt-get –y install bind9
Sekarang kita akan masuk di file bindnya , ketik perintah dibawah in;
cd /etc/bind
untuk melihat semua directory yg ada pada file bind ketik perintah : ls
kita akan membackup file di bind agar nanti jika ada salah pengetikan kita bisa mengcopy ulang file yang rusak. KetiK perintah dibawah ini untuk mengcopy file:
cp named.conf.default-zones named.conf --> tekan enter
cp db.local db.1 --> tekan enter
cp db.127 db.2 --> tekan enter
setelah itu kita akan masuk di file named.conf, dengan mengetik perintah dibawah ini:
nano named.conf
lau edit file tersebut sesuai dengan gambar dibawah ini:
Kemudian kita masuk lagi di file db.1 , dengan mengetik perintah di bawah ini:
nano db.1
Edit file db.1 seperti pada gambar dibawah ini :
Selanjutnya file db.2 yg akan kita edit , tapi kita masuk dlu di file db.2 , ketik perintah dibawah ini :
nano db.2
Edit file db.2 seperti pada gambar di bawah ini:
Lalu ketik perintah dibawah ini :
nano named.conf.options
jika anda sudah masuk, kita hanya akan mengganti ip 0.0.0.0. ,
Mejadi ip 192.168.1.1 (ip adress yang pertama).
Ketik perintah dibawah ini:
nano /etc/resolv.conf
hapus semua tulisan yang ada di didalam file tersebut, lalu ketik masuk servername dan ip address dibawah ini:
servername 192.168.1.1
servername 192.168.1.2
servername 192.168.1.3
sekarang kita akan merestart bind, dengan ketik perintah dibawah ini:
/etc/init.d/bind9 restart
Nah kita akan mengecek apakah sudah konek atau belum, dengan mengetik perintah dibawah ini:
nslookup ns.tkj.com
nslookup mail.tkj.com
jika sudah conect tampilannya akan seperti dibawah ini:
Konfigurasi DNS server sudah selesai ..
Konfigurasi Web server...
Pertama kita akan menginstall apache2, dengan mengetik perintah dibawah ini:
apt-get –y install apache2 php5 php5-cgi libapache2-mod-php5
Ketik perintah di bawah ini untuk masuk diapache2:
cd /etc/apache2/sites-enabled
Kemudian ketik perintah dibawah ini :
nano www
akan muncul tampilan kosong, dan ketik masuk perintah dibawah ini :
<VirtualHost *>
DocumentRoot /var/www
ErrorLog /var/log/apache2/error.log
</VirtualHost>
seperti gambar di bawah ini:
Setelah selesai, simpan perintah yang telah di ketik tadi, selanjutnya ketik perintah dibawah ini:
cd /var/www
sekarang kita akan mengedit laman web kita, ketik perintah dibawah ini:
nano index.html
semua tulisan yang berwarna putih dapat diedit, seperti pada gambar dibawah ini:
Semua konfigurasi telah selesai, sekarang kita akan merestart apache2, dengan mengetik perintah dibawah ini:
/etc/init.d/apache2 restart
Sekarang kita akan melihat hasil webserver, tapi kita harus menginsatall lynx, ketik perintah dibawah ini untuk menginstall lynx :
apt-get –y install lynx
Setelah selesai menginstall lynx, ketik perintah dibawah ini untuk melihat hasil webserver anda:
jika berhasil tampilannya akan seperti dibawah ini:
Jika sudah berhasil , Tekan q untuk keluar lalu tekan y .
Konfigurasi webserver telah selesai.
Konfigurasi mail server...
Pertama kita akan menginstall postfix dengan mengetik perintah dibawah ini, jangan lupa memasukan cd master debiannya .
apt-get –y install postfix
akan muncul tampilan seperti bawah ini , tekan saja enter:
Setelah andah memilih ok di atas, akan muncul lagi tampilan seperti dibawah ini , pilih internet site lalu ok:
Nah sekarang tahap terakhir dari penginstalan postfix , akan muncul tampilan seperti dibawah ini:
Ganti mail name menjadi tkj.com (sesuai dengan nama domain anda), seperti pada gambar diatas.
Masukan cd 2 debian 6 lalu Ketik perintah ini : apt-cdrom add
Lalu ketik perintah ini untuk menginstall courier-imap
apt-get –y install courier-imap
Jika berhasil tampilannya seperti dibawah ini:
Selanjutnya kita akan menginstall courier-pop jangan keluarkan cd 2 debian , lalu ketik perintah dibawah ini:
apt-get –y install courier-pop
Masuk kan cd 1 jika tampilan seperti dibawah ini:
Debian akan meminta anda lagi untuk memasukan cd 2, jadi masukan cd 2 apabila muncul tampilan seperti dibawah ini:
Tahap terakhir akan muncul tampilan seperti dibawah ini: pilih NO.
Kita akan lanjut ke konfigurasi selanjutnya, ketik perintah dibawah ini: (Maildir = M di depan huruf besar)
maildirmake.courier /etc/skel/Maildir
sekarang kita akan menbuat user, ketik perintah dibawah ini:
adduser server (terserah anda) --> masukan password
anda disuruh memasukan full name, room number, work phone, home phone, other, tekan saja enter . seperti pada gambar di bawah ini:
akan muncul pertanyaan : is the information correct [y/n] : (tekan y)
buat lagi user lain dengan perintah : adduser client (masukkan pasword , dsb . sama dengan cara di atas)
selesai membuat user, ketik perintah dibawah ini:
echo “home_mailbox = Maildir/” >> /etc/postifix/main.cf
(ingat M di depan Maildir huruf besar)
Lanjut ke perintah selanjutnya ketik perintah dibawah ini:
dpkg-reconfigure postfix
Akan muncul tampilan seperti di bawah ini, tekan saja ENTER.
Tekan ENTER
Tekan ENTER
Tambahkan di depan tkj.com, (mail.tkj.com) seperti pada gambar dibawah ini:
Setelah itu tekan saja ENTER pada gamabar dibawah ini:
Tekan ENTER
Pilih NO lalu tekan ENTER.
Tekan ENTER.
Tekan ENTER.
Tekan ENTER.
Selesai itu , kita akan menginstall squirrelmail, ketik perintah dibawah ini:
apt-get –y install squirrelmail
Masukan dulu cd 2 , lalu cd 1 seperti pada saat menginstall courier-imap.
Kita akan masuk di apache2, ketik perintah di bawah ini untuk masuk di apache2 :
cd /etc/apache2
Lalu kita akan mengedit file apache2.conf, ketik perintah dibawah ini:
nano / etc/apache2.conf
Tekan ctrl+w lalu ketik kata include . tambahkan dibawah kata (Include /etc/squirrelmail/apache.conf , huruf I pada Include huruf besar) include , seperti pada gambar dibawah ini:
Selanjutnya, ketik perintah dibawah ini:
nano /etc/squirrelmail/apache.conf
tekan arah bawah cari kata VirtualHost, kemudian hilangkan tanda pagar di depan sampai VirtualHost yang di bawah seperti pada gambar dibawah ini:
Nah semua konfigurasii telah selesai tinggal merestart apache2 dengan mengetik perintah dibawah ini:
/etc/init.d/apache2 restart
Kemudian kita akan mencoba mail yang telah kita buat, ketik perintah dibawah ini:
lynx mail.tkj.com
akan muncul seperti gambar dibawah ini, masukan nama user anda besarta paswordnya.
lalu pilih tab compose, ketik nama user yang akan di kirimi pesan (to), lalu isi judul (subject), dan juga isi pesan, Kemudian send. Seperti pada gambar dibawah ini:
Logout user server, kemudian login user client sama pada saat login user server tadi , jika sudah ada pesan pada user yang anda kirimi pesan maka, konfigurasi mail server anda telah berhasil, seperti pada gambar dibawah ini:
SELAMAT MENCOBA
AND
GOOD LUCK